Corrosion inhibitors are critical in mitigating metal degradation across multiple industrial sectors, including oil and gas, chemical processing, marine, water treatment, and manufacturing. Their primary role is to protect equipment, pipelines, and infrastructure from corrosion-related damage, thereby extending service life, enhancing safety, and reducing maintenance expenses. Increasing industrialization, stricter environmental regulations, and rising awareness of asset protection have significantly fueled the adoption of these chemicals worldwide. The versatility and efficiency of corrosion inhibitors make them indispensable for both established and emerging markets.

The oil and gas industry remains one of the largest consumers of corrosion inhibitors due to exposure to harsh operational conditions, including high pressure, temperature variations, and saline environments. Water treatment facilities utilize these chemicals to prevent microbial and algae-induced corrosion in cooling towers and industrial water systems. Marine applications are also significant, as inhibitors protect ships, offshore platforms, and equipment exposed to seawater. Adoption across these critical sectors reinforces the market’s relevance and growth potential.
